The upper levels of the vein are hosted primarily by rhyolite tuffs, whereas some deeper vein-intercepts occur in the more favourable diorite host rock. Initial shallow drilling at La Luisa returned vein intercepts with higher gold concentrations relative to silver and low concentrations of base metals. The low silver to gold ratios and low concentrations of base metals observed are analogous to the previously reported shallow "gold rich" horizon at the southern end of Napoleon (see the Company's press releases dated
Previous surface mapping and sampling at La Luisa has returned higher silver and gold anomalies at surface in the north. More recently, mapping with the use of Terraspec® has aided in the characterization of alteration minerals located along strike, supporting the hypothesis that mineralization is tilted to the southwest (see surface samples on Figure 2 and alteration minerals represented by dotted lines in Figure 5). Shallow drilling completed in the northwest have confirmed vein mineralization in the north and expanded the potential strike length of La Luisa to 1,670 m; with an intermediate ~400 m drilling-gap between the high-grade shoot in the south and the recent drill intercepts to the north (see Figure 2). New analysis of metal ratios and alteration mineralogy, now allow us to define a more favorable target elevation (silver rich target) in the 400m gap, constrained by the Ag/Au=100 isolines, between the northern holes and the mineral resource footprint in the south. Vizsla intends to explore this refined up section target between the Ag/Au=100 isolines in an effort to further expand mineral resources at La Luisa.

The newly consolidated
The district contains intermediate to low sulfidation epithermal silver and gold deposits related to siliceous volcanism and crustal extension in the Oligocene and Miocene. Host rocks are mainly continental volcanic rocks correlated to the Tarahumara Formation.

Pursuant to CIM Definition Standards, "inferred mineral resources" are that part of a mineral resource for which quantity and grade or quality are estimated on the basis of limited geological evidence and sampling. Such geological evidence is sufficient to imply but not verify geological and grade or quality continuity. An inferred mineral resource has a lower level of confidence than that applying to an indicated mineral resource and must not be converted to a mineral reserve. However, it is reasonably expected that the majority of inferred mineral resources could be upgraded to indicated mineral resources with continued exploration. Under Canadian rules, estimates of inferred mineral resources may not form the basis of feasibility or pre-feasibility studies, except in rare cases.
